titleOfInvention Surface immobilized polyelectrolyte with multiple functional groups capable of covalently bonding to biomolecules
abstract A polyelectrolyte having multiple exposed functional groups, each such group being capable of covalently bonding to a molecule, is immobilized on a surface for the purpose of bonding to a biomolecule. The biomolecule can be, for example, a nucleic acid, e.g., an amine functionalized oligonucleotide. The polyelectrolyte can include, e.g., BSA (Bovine Serum Albumin) which is bound to a functionalized surface using a covalent immobilization strategy, e.g., reaction with the surface of a tosyl-activated microparticle. Following such reaction, exposed reactive functional groups on the protein, such as amine, carboxyl, thiol, hydroxyl groups can further be utilized to covalently couple the oligonucleotide of interest using suitable chemistry.
